Output 3fbab33b87268008507158f15efab851ccc1ca44104e894c436b844b994229bc:20

value
3100000
script pubkey
OP_0 OP_PUSHBYTES_20 6fa26c4c3165ca205c511e7fe2676ebdbb6b911b
address
bc1qd73xcnp3vh9zqhz3rel7yemwhkakhygmvt9lvy
transaction
3fbab33b87268008507158f15efab851ccc1ca44104e894c436b844b994229bc
confirmations
108305
spent
true